Removal
1.
CAUTION: Never work on a vehicle supported solely by a jack. Always support the vehicle securely.
Raise and support the vehicle.
2. Remove the clutch pressure plate and driven plate. For more information, refer to Clutch Driven and Pressure Plates (33.10.01)
3.
NOTE: Secure the flywheel to prevent it from rotating.
Remove the flywheel. Remove the 8 Torx head bolts.

Installation
1.
CAUTION: Tighten the bolts in a crisscross pattern.
NOTE: Secure the flywheel to prevent it from rotating.
Install the flywheel.
- Clean the contact surfaces of the parts.
- Tighten the mounting bolts in 3 stages.
- Tighten the Torx head bolts (tightening torque 45 Nm).
- Tighten the Torx head bolts to 45 degrees.
- Tighten the Torx head bolts an additional 45 degrees.

2. Install the clutch slave and pressure plates. For more information, refer to Clutch Slave and Pressure Plates (33.10.01)
